## SurveyTrek environments — offline mode

Offline mode for the field-survey app is enabled in staging and pilot only. Sync conflicts queue locally and reconcile on reconnect; production stays online-only until the Darnley trial wraps. For this week's sync, note that the pilot environment currently runs with these values.

settings of tagef-bawif:
DRUIX_HOST=druix.zemvarlabs.internal
DRUIX_PORT=8000

Subject: ORM refactor handover — Velgrath inventory service

For the weekly sync: the legacy Quillmapper ORM layer in the Velgrath inventory service is half-migrated to the new repository pattern. Reads go through the new layer; writes still use the old session objects. Don't merge anything touching `stock_moves` until the dual-write shim lands. All work targets the staging replica, reachable via the connection string below.

warehouse DSN: mssql://rusdor_svc:0FSWCn9@db-951a.paliqforge.local:5432/ulawyn

**Finance Review Summary — Transition to Annual Billing**

This summary is prepared for the incoming director. Our review of the proposed shift from monthly to annual billing for the Corvela platform indicates a one-time cash-flow uplift in Q2, offset by an estimated 3% churn risk among smaller accounts. Discounting assumptions were tested under three scenarios; all remain margin-positive. Collections workload at the Fernside office would fall materially. The commercial strategy this billing change supports is set out below.

board note of bawep-tajef: Queniusek Systems plans to raise the Quenvan list price by 53.1 percent in March. The pricing group signed off on a budget of $176.4 million for Project Drueth. The renewal with Casionix Partners closes at $142.5 million a year, 8.3 percent below the last contract. Project Fraax slips by six weeks because of the tooling delay.